什么是黑洞路由和解决方法,超详细

这篇具有很好参考价值的文章主要介绍了什么是黑洞路由和解决方法,超详细。希望对大家有所帮助。如果存在错误或未考虑完全的地方,请大家不吝赐教,您也可以点击"举报违法"按钮提交疑问。

1、首先我们要了解一下BGP的通告原则之四:BGP与IGP同步

(从IBGP邻居学习到的路由,在IGP中也要学习到,否则路由无效)

2、路由黑洞的产生是因为BGP与IGP同步检查默认是不开启而导致的

3、这里以下图解释一下

什么是黑洞路由和解决方法,超详细

R1与R2建立EBGP邻居

R2与R4建立非直连IBGP邻居

R3不建邻居

R4与R5建EBGP邻居

AS200底层的IGP协议为OSPF

然后再R1宣告一条BGP路由192.168.1.1,此时R1会将该路由传递给邻居R2,然后R4再从IGBP邻居收到该BGP路由,,下一跳为2.2.2.2(R2)如图。

什么是黑洞路由和解决方法,超详细

然后由于同步没有开启,R4直接将该路由传给R5,如图。

什么是黑洞路由和解决方法,超详细

当R5去访问该BGP路由192.168.1.1时,下一跳为R4,便传给R4,在R4的BGP路由表里192.168.1.1 的下一跳为2.2.2.2,但R4与R2并没有真实的直连链路,所以得通过R3,但在R3路由器的路由表里并没有该路由,因此该往哪里走便将该数据包丢弃,导致R5无法访问192.168.1.1,这便是黑洞路由

什么是黑洞路由和解决方法,超详细

4、解决方法

  • 在数据包所经过的路径上开启BGP

  • 将部分的BGP路由引入到IGP

  • 使用MPLS,即使中间路由器没有路由,数据包也根据标签转发。

       需要配置命令 Route recursive-lookup tunnel 下一跳迭代进隧道文章来源地址https://www.toymoban.com/news/detail-454720.html

到了这里,关于什么是黑洞路由和解决方法,超详细的文章就介绍完了。如果您还想了解更多内容,请在右上角搜索TOY模板网以前的文章或继续浏览下面的相关文章,希望大家以后多多支持TOY模板网!

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处: 如若内容造成侵权/违法违规/事实不符,请点击违法举报进行投诉反馈,一经查实,立即删除!

领支付宝红包 赞助服务器费用

相关文章

  • 路由器重启后电脑无法联网怎么办?有什么解决方法

    在学校或某些使用交换机路由器组成局域网的场合,如果设备出现停电,往往会有些电脑无法联网。那该如何解决呢?本文将为大家介绍一个解决方法,希望对大家有所帮助 路由器重启后电脑无法联网的解决方法: 1、此类故障的停网一般不会出现全部电脑无法联网的情况,

    2024年02月06日
    浏览(60)
  • 无线路由器信号差怎么办详细排除和解决方法

    无线路由器信号的原因很多种,有物理干扰,也有位置不佳,也有可能是无线接收端如手机的问题,也有可能是无线路由器本身的问题。但一般情况下问题排除和解决方法也不难。 工具/原料 无线路由器 SSID 电脑或手机等无线终端 方法/步骤 首先,为了我们可以看看我们的路

    2024年02月05日
    浏览(75)
  • HCIA——10实验:跨路由转发。静态路由、负载均衡、缺省路由、手工汇总、环回接口。空接口与路由黑洞、浮动静态。

    跨路由转发、负载均衡、环回接口、手工汇总、缺省路由、空接口与路由黑洞、浮动静态 跨路由转发 静态路由、负载均衡、缺省路由、手工汇总。环回接口 空接口与路由黑洞、浮动静态 目录 学习目标: 学习内容: 1.跨路由转发 1)第一次PING 2.静态路由、负载均衡、缺省路由

    2024年01月17日
    浏览(48)
  • 【JAVA】我们常常谈到的方法是指什么?

    个人主页:【😊个人主页】 系列专栏:【❤️初识JAVA】 在之前的文章中我们总是会介绍到类中的各式各样的方法,也许在应用中我们对它已经有了初步的了解,今天我们就来详细的介绍一下“方法” 在中文中方法常常指的是获得某种东西或达到某种目的而采取的手段与行

    2024年02月13日
    浏览(45)
  • 计算机提示vcruntime140.dll丢失是什么意思?vcruntime140.dll丢失的解决方法(详细方法)

    计算机丢失vcruntime140.dll是什么意思?经常看到有小伙伴有在网上问这样的问题,电脑上这个vcruntime140.dll文件丢失的问题经常发生吧,那么就很有必要给大家详细的说说这一方面的问题了,下面我们来看看 第一:vcruntime140.dll的修复方法 1 1.首先将电脑开机,进到主页面之后,

    2024年02月04日
    浏览(76)
  • mfc110u.dll丢失的解决方法?mfc110u.dll是什么?详细介绍

    mfc110u.dll是Microsoft Foundation Class(MFC)版本11.0的动态链接库(DLL)文件。它是为Microsoft Visual Studio 2012编程工具集制作的。该文件包含为C++编写的MFC类的定义,这些类是用于Windows应用程序开发的基本库之一。在打开游戏或者游戏程序的时候,如果mfc110u.dll丢失会导致很多软件跟

    2024年02月16日
    浏览(44)
  • 针对java中list.parallelStream()的多线程数据安全问题我们采用什么方法最好呢?

    当使用List.parallelStream()方法进行多线程处理时,可能会涉及到数据安全问题。下面是一些常见的方法来处理parallelStream()的多线程数据安全问题: 1. 使用线程安全的集合:Java中提供了线程安全的集合类,如CopyOnWriteArrayList和synchronizedList等。可以将原始的List转换为线程安全的集

    2024年02月10日
    浏览(41)
  • 什么是硬路由和软路由 如何废掉硬路由组建软路由的详细教程

    谈起路由,可能刚接触的朋友也不太明白什么是“软”路由,在这里笔者就简单介绍一下软路由与硬路由之间的区别。而我们平常生活上所接触得比较多的就是“硬”路由。所谓硬路由就是以特用的硬设备,包括处理器、电源供应、嵌入式软件,提供设定的路由器功能。  软

    2024年02月05日
    浏览(30)
  • 微软应用商店无法使用问题记录-微软商店提示“我们这边出错了”的解决方法

    引用自 微软商店提示“我们这边出错了”的解决方法 如下: win+s启用搜索,输入services或者中文服务 或者win+r运行,输入services.msc 在服务应用界面找到Microsoft Store安装服务,双击打开或右键单击选择属性。将启动类型设置为自动,再点击下方的启动按钮。 这样还解决不了问

    2024年02月12日
    浏览(67)
  • 路由器劫持是什么意思为什么要劫持路由器有哪些方法可以防范

    继“棱镜门”事件之后,网络安全也随之被各大媒体关注,近段时间有不少媒体报道,全球拥有大量的路由器遭入侵、路由器被劫持等等。另外在如今越来越多的无线网络环境中,蹭网也是常常被人们提及,那么路由器劫持是什么意思?怎么看路由器是否被劫持?针对这两个

    2024年02月07日
    浏览(69)

觉得文章有用就打赏一下文章作者

支付宝扫一扫打赏

博客赞助

微信扫一扫打赏

请作者喝杯咖啡吧~博客赞助

支付宝扫一扫领取红包,优惠每天领

二维码1

领取红包

二维码2

领红包